Address

NT3ojW5wXxgRa1XcH3rr4MvXhHhzHFQGnT

0 XNA

Confirmed
Total Received425.72757493 XNA
Total Sent425.72757493 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NT3ojW5wXxgRa1XcH3rr4MvXhHhzHFQGnT425.72757493 XNA
 
 
NT3ojW5wXxgRa1XcH3rr4MvXhHhzHFQGnT425.72757493 XNA